Jon Burlingame Not so long ago, composers doing “genre” material — horror, science fiction, fantasy — saw an Oscar or Emmy nomination as a longshot, namely because voters didn’t seem to take those projects seriously.But times have changed.

Six of the 11 nominees in Emmy’s two narrative-fiction music categories have some element of sci-fi, fantasy or horror, in addition to two of the nominated songs, two main-title themes and four of the music supervision nominees.Why the turnabout?

Variety asked several of this year’s music nominees for their thoughts, and each offered a slightly different answer.“When you talk about awards recognition, a lot of the time it’s really about what’s in the collective consciousness,” says TV Academy music.
